The Department of Commerce has had the privilege of being one of the six departments which were initially started with the establishment of the University of Gorakhpur in 1957. Teaching at PG level only could start with the help of 04 faculty members- Dr. PK. Dwivedi. Dr A.P. Baijal. Dr. PN. Singh and Dr. Mithleshwar Singh headed by Dr. A.B. Mishra. Following the merger of the erstwhile MP Degree College in July, 1958 the strength of the faculty members increased and classes of both UG and PG were started from the academic session 1958-59. Dr. A.B. Mishra had been the first Head of the Department from 1957 to 1962. In November 1962, Dr. R.L. Agrawal took over as the first Professor and Head of the Department and as a result of his keen interest and continued efforts: the department diversified its activities in 1965 by starting three-year part-time PG Diploma in Business Management in June, 1975, Prof. A.P. Baijal took over charge of Head of the Department. Under his dynamic leadership bearing the acumen of a specialist, the Department emerged as one of the largest departments of the University increasing the faculty members to 23, imparting teaching and research facilities to a vast number of students. In the year 1989 the PG building of the department was constructed and in February 1989 XIX Joint-Annual conference of the Indian Association for Management Development and Inter-University Council for Business Education was organized. Prof. D.P. Agraval took over as Head of the Department in 1995. During his tenure, the department started long awaited M.B.A. Programme under the self-finance scheme which was recognized as a separate department in the year 2004 and since then its running successfully from October 2022 its been shifted to a newly constituted Faculty of Management. During the last three decades, the department achieved newer heights under the Headship of Prof. S.N. Chaturvedi, Prof. I.A. Ansari, Prof. T.PN. Srivastava, Prof. M.C. Gupta, Prof. Gopinath, Prof. A. K Tiwari, Prof Vinay Kumar Pandey, Prof.A Sen Gupta. Presently, the Department is headed by Prof. Shrivardhan Pathak , under his dynamic leadership the Department is making rapid strides. His commitment for academic pursuits have motivated the faculty members to channelize their efforts in organizing seminar, conferences, workshops in the department so that the students and scholars have an opportunity to interact with distinguished faculty members from different parts of the country. He is assisted by highly qualified and dynamic faculty members viz; Prof. Ravi Pratap Singh, Prof. Sanjay Baijal, Prof. Ajeya Kumar Gupta, Prof. Ashish Kumar Srivastava, Prof. Sanjeet Kumar Gupta, Prof. Rajeev Prabhakar, Prof Anil Kumar Yadav, Prof. Manish Kumar Srivastva Dr. Pratima Jaiswal, Dr Harshdev Verma, Dr. Anshu Gupta, Dr. Maneesh Kumar, Dr. Suman Kannoujia , Dr. Pradeep Kumar, and Dr Rahul Mishra all having decades of teaching and research experience,. The department has specialized faculty members in all of the areas of Finance, Marketing, Business Taxation, Human Resource Management, Research Methodology.
The faculty members of the department are actively engaged in advanced researches in the field of Commerce and Management and have presented their research papers and articles in various National/ International Seminars and Conferences. The faculty members of the department have presented above 380 research papers/ articles in various national and international seminars/ conferences and above 450 papers have been published in various journals of repute. The members of the department are occupying various key positions in the corporate life of the University and are contributing substantially in the achievement of the mission of the university. The department has successfully organized Four National Seminars and Eight Refresher Courses for University and College teachers, till now. The department has also restructured the UG and PG courses in accordance with the UGC guidelines under New Education policy and has introduced Choice Based Credit System (CBCS) at UG level along with PG semester system, revising its course structure thoroughly. The department has started B. Com (Banking & Insurance) in the self-finance mode since 2021. The tough and testing time of Covid pandemic in 2019-21 could not deter the faculty members from performing their duties, all the classes were regularly conducted through virtual platform to the satisfaction of students. On July 2, 2021, the Department organised its first *International Alumni Meet' with the wide participation of alumni throughout the world. A workshop on Research Methodology (virtual mode) was also organised from July 4-10, 2021. At present more than 70 students are registered as research scholars in the department including Junior Research Fellows and Senior Research Fellow. It is also worth mentioning that several students of the Department have qualified the UGC National Eligibility Test (NET) in 2020-21.
